Summary
The purpose of this study is to investigate the magnitude of changes in biomarkers of exercise-induced muscle damage following an acute bout of eccentric exercise of the knee extensors performed on an isokinetic dynamometer. Moreover, these biomarkers will be assessed at different time points after the initial intervention, checking the repeated bout effect phenomenon.
Detailed description
Volunteers will visit the laboratory a total of two times. During the first visit, in all participants will be assessed indirect markers of exercise-induced muscle damage (i.e., peak torque, delayed-onset muscle soreness, range of motion, rate of force development), blood parameters (i.e., creatine kinase and c-Reactive Protein), and muscle oxygenation using near infrared spectroscopy. Afterwards, participants will perform an eccentric exercise protocol for the knee extensors consisting of 5 sets of 15 maximal-intensity repetitions at an angular velocity of 60°/s. The second visit will be at different time points between participant, where the indirect mauls damage biomarkers will be reassessed before and after the same isokinetic eccentric exercise (i.e., 5 sets of 15 maximal-intensity repetitions at an angular velocity of 60°/s).
